Other Resources |
Benjamin Franklin (Frank) Bean, "Dr. B.F. Bean has practiced medicine in Jasper County for almost 40 years. He served two terms in the lower house of the State Legislature."
Bean Family: Descendants of Alexander (Mac) Bean.
B.F. Bean, M.D., birth date 2/12/1859, death date 1/3/1947 in Kirbyville, Jasper County, doctor.
FamilySearch Texas Deaths, 1890-1976.
Dr. B.F. Bean (1859-1947), burial in Bean Cemetery, Kirbyville, Jasper County; photo of marker "Free Burial Ground Courtesy of Dr. B.F. Bean."
Find a Grave. Bean Cemetery
Dr. B.F. Bean
Benjamin Franklin Bean, birth date 2/15/1859 in Magnolia Springs, Jasper County, death date 1/3/1947 in Kirbyville, Jasper County. Married four times between 1877 and 1901: Minnie Beck (1877), Mary Huffpour (1884), McClearie Elizabeth Withers (1887), and Sarah Angeline Withers (1901).
RootsWeb.com Internet genealogical service.
26th Legislature (1899) - B.F. Bean, Kirbyville, age 39, doctor, Democrat.
Texas Legislative Manual.
